Subject: Cage visit tonight — Vantrex DC, Hall 2

Night shift,

Tech from Osslun Systems arrives around 01:30 to swap drives in cage 14, Hall 2. Escort required at all times — no exceptions. Log entry and exit in the visit register at the desk. He has his own tools; nothing leaves the cage without sign-off from Priya on shift lead duty. Cage key is in the lockbox as usual. Use the following pass to get him through the mantrap.

badge for badup-kahif: bdg-LHI-9

Subject: Mail room relocation — action for reception

Hi all, from next Wednesday the mail room at Copperfield Wharf moves from Basement 1 to Ground Floor West, beside goods-in. Please update the courier instructions sheet at the desk and redirect any drivers who head for the old lift. Internal post collection times are unchanged. The new room's door is keypad-controlled; until badges are reprogrammed, use the code below.

staff pass of kawip-hawef = bdg-QLP-2

Runbook — Hollowmere queue-depth autoscaler. If worker pods are flapping, first confirm the scaler isn't oscillating: check that scale-up and scale-down cooldowns haven't been overridden by a recent deploy. Never pause the scaler during peak ingest; drain a partition instead. Before paging the data team, verify the scaler is running with exactly these values:

settings of fafog-haduf:
ZORIX_PIN=4648
ZORIX_METRICS_HOST=metrics.zorix.paliqsys.corp
ZORIX_LOG_LEVEL=info
ZORIX_TENANT=druix